- Summary
- After a DUI sent him down the rabbit hole of the American prison system, Jacob Harlon was transformed into Money, a stoic and ruthless prison gangster. Upon his release from prison, he learns that the grip of his new family, the prison gang, goes beyond bars. Chased by law enforcement and threatened by his incarcerated 'protectors', he must orchestrate one last dangerous crime
